Overview

COUGH is the #2 most commonly reported adverse reaction for LOPERAMIDE HYDROCHLORIDE AND SIMETHICONE, manufactured by Aurohealth LLC. There are 3 FDA adverse event reports linking LOPERAMIDE HYDROCHLORIDE AND SIMETHICONE to COUGH. This represents approximately 2.1% of all 142 adverse event reports for this drug.

Patients taking LOPERAMIDE HYDROCHLORIDE AND SIMETHICONE who experience cough should discuss this symptom with their healthcare provider to determine whether it may be related to their medication and what alternatives may be available.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does LOPERAMIDE HYDROCHLORIDE AND SIMETHICONE cause COUGH?

COUGH has been reported as an adverse event in 3 FDA reports for LOPERAMIDE HYDROCHLORIDE AND SIMETHICONE. This does not prove causation, but indicates an association observed in post-market surveillance data.
